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ma in frame

The Mumbai Cricket Association might honor Rohit Sharma with a stand at the Arun Jaitely Stadium, similar to what the Delhi and District Cricket Association (DDCA) did for Virat Kohli in 2019. The MCA is in a bind, too, as the India captain's name would be compared to other Mumbai icons for naming stands and walking bridges surrounding the Wankhede stadium. Eight demands and proposals have been submitted to MCA by its club members, according to a report from the Indian Express.

Former presidents Sharad Pawar and Vilasrao Deshmukh are among the names, as are former India captain Ajit Wadekar, the late Eknath Solkar, the late Dilip Sardesai, the late Padmakar Shivalkar, Diana Edulji, the former India women's captain, and Rohit.

"There have been suggestions from members and the final decision will be taken by the general body members of the Mumbai Cricket Association," MCA president Ajinkya Naik told the national daily.

According to reports, the decision will be made when Rohit's name is brought up in the MCA's Apex Council meeting on April 15. The 37-year-old guided India to consecutive ICC championship victories in the past ten months, including the Champions Trophy victory in Dubai last month and the T20 World Cup victory in Barbados in June 2024. This achievement has never been surpassed by any other Mumbai player. In addition, he guided India to the 2023 ODI World Cup final, meaning that they have now only lost one of their previous 24 white-ball matches in an ICC competition.

According to the source, the MCA only possesses one unnamed Grand Stand inside Wankhede Stadium, and that is located over the president's box. The East Stand is named after the renowned Sunil Gavaskar, the West Stand after Vijay Merchant, and the North Stand after Dilip Vengsarkar and Sachin Tendulkar. However, MCA is in a challenging position with few options left to fulfill after receiving up to eight requests. Rohit, on the other hand, is now playing for the Mumbai Indians in the IPL 2025 season.
